From an analyst’s perspective:

Charter Communications Inc. [NASDAQ: CHTR] stock has seen the most recent analyst activity on July 31, 2024, when Wolfe Research downgraded its rating to a Peer Perform. Previously, Raymond James downgraded its rating to Underperform on July 29, 2024. On July 03, 2024, downgrade downgraded it’s rating to Sell and revised its price target to $255 on the stock. Goldman started tracking the stock assigning a Sell rating and suggested a price target of $250 on July 01, 2024. Pivotal Research Group reiterated its recommendation of a Buy and reduced its price target to $400 on April 29, 2024. Bernstein upgraded its rating to Outperform for this stock on March 18, 2024, but kept the price target unchanged to $370. In a note dated February 20, 2024, Rosenblatt downgraded an Neutral rating on this stock.

Analyzing the CHTR fundamentals

The Charter Communications Inc. [NASDAQ:CHTR] reported sales of 54.66B for trailing twelve months, representing a surge of 0.19%. Gross Profit Margin for this corporation currently stands at 0.46% with Operating Profit Margin at 0.23%, Pretax Profit Margin comes in at 0.13%, and Net Profit Margin reading is 0.09%. To continue investigating profitability, this company’s Return on Assets is posted at 0.03, Equity is 0.4 and Total Capital is 0.09. An extended analysis of the company’s primary financial structure reveals a debt-to-equity ratio of7.51.

Ratios To Look Out For

It’s worth pointing out that Charter Communications Inc. [NASDAQ:CHTR]’s Current Ratio is 0.39. Further, the Quick Ratio stands at 0.39, while the Cash Ratio is 0.06. Considering the valuation of this stock, the price to sales ratio is 0.97, the price to book ratio is 4.14 and price to earnings (TTM) ratio is 11.90.
